Class TXQTerm_Visitor

DescriptionHierarchyFieldsMethodsProperties

Unit

Declaration

type TXQTerm_Visitor = class(TObject)

Description

Hierarchy

  • TObject
  • TXQTerm_Visitor

Overview

Fields

Public parent: TXQTerm;

Methods

Public procedure declare(intentionallyUnusedParameter: PXQTermVariable); virtual;
Public procedure undeclare(intentionallyUnusedParameter: PXQTermVariable); virtual;
Public function visit (intentionallyUnusedParameter: PXQTerm): TXQTerm_VisitAction; virtual;
Public function leave (intentionallyUnusedParameter: PXQTerm): TXQTerm_VisitAction; virtual;
Public class function startVisiting(term: PXQTerm): TXQTerm_VisitAction;
Public function simpleTermVisit (term: PXQTerm; theparent: TXQTerm): TXQTerm_VisitAction;

Description

Fields

Public parent: TXQTerm;
 

Methods

Public procedure declare(intentionallyUnusedParameter: PXQTermVariable); virtual;
 
Public procedure undeclare(intentionallyUnusedParameter: PXQTermVariable); virtual;
 
Public function visit (intentionallyUnusedParameter: PXQTerm): TXQTerm_VisitAction; virtual;
 
Public function leave (intentionallyUnusedParameter: PXQTerm): TXQTerm_VisitAction; virtual;
 
Public class function startVisiting(term: PXQTerm): TXQTerm_VisitAction;
 
Public function simpleTermVisit (term: PXQTerm; theparent: TXQTerm): TXQTerm_VisitAction;
 

Generated by PasDoc 0.14.0.